Lifecycle carbon intensity of electricity in Morocco
Morocco: Lifecycle carbon intensity of electricity was 596.4 grams of CO₂ equivalents per kilowatt-hour in 2025. ▼ Falling
Lifecycle carbon intensity of electricity in Morocco, 2000–2025
Source: Ember (2026) – with major processing by Our World in Data. Measured in grams of CO₂ equivalents per kilowatt-hour.
Analysis
Morocco recorded 596.4 grams of CO₂ equivalents per kilowatt-hour for lifecycle carbon intensity of electricity in 2025.
That represents a change of up 0.3% on the previous year and down 6.8% over ten years.
Over the whole period, lifecycle carbon intensity of electricity in Morocco peaked at 769.23 grams of CO₂ equivalents per kilowatt-hour in 2001 and was at its lowest, 594.81 grams of CO₂ equivalents per kilowatt-hour, in 2024.
That places Morocco 60th out of 213 countries with data for 2025, putting it in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 26 years of available data.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 722.6 grams of CO₂ equivalents per kilowatt-hour | 635.45 grams of CO₂ equivalents per kilowatt-hour | 769.23 grams of CO₂ equivalents per kilowatt-hour | 10 |
| 2010s | 633.98 grams of CO₂ equivalents per kilowatt-hour | 610.5 grams of CO₂ equivalents per kilowatt-hour | 652.71 grams of CO₂ equivalents per kilowatt-hour | 10 |
| 2020s | 625.96 grams of CO₂ equivalents per kilowatt-hour | 594.81 grams of CO₂ equivalents per kilowatt-hour | 662.64 grams of CO₂ equivalents per kilowatt-hour | 6 |
